The Buckeye Scoop's press conference with Josh Simmons and other Ohio State players offers an in-depth look at the team's preparation for the upcoming season, emphasizing resilience, leadership, and cultural excellence. Players and coaches highlight the challenges and rewards of adapting to Chip Kelly’s dynamic offense, with a strong focus on mental toughness, consistency, and daily improvement. Josh Simmons reflects on his personal journey from uncertainty to leadership, crediting faith, discipline, and mentorship for his growth. The team’s culture of competition, accountability, and humility is reinforced through peer-driven development, rigorous training, and a collective drive toward a national championship. Defensive players underscore the importance of technique, discipline, and controlling the middle of the field, while offensive players discuss chemistry with quarterbacks and the need to seize every opportunity. The integration of new talent, including Lathan Ransom’s return and Caleb Downs’ transfer, is seen as a catalyst for increased cohesion and depth. Throughout the episode, recurring themes include the value of process over results, the importance of earning one’s role through performance, and the role of veteran leadership in shaping younger players. Simmons and other players emphasize that success stems not from talent alone, but from relentless effort, adaptability, and a spiritual foundation. The transition to the NFL is framed as a natural progression, with Ohio State’s high-tempo, pro-style system serving as exceptional preparation. Coaches and players alike stress the significance of physical transformation, mental resilience, and team chemistry in achieving excellence. The episode closes with strategic insights into upcoming opponents, particularly mobile quarterbacks and elite running backs, underscoring the need for disciplined aggression and a dominant front four.
